> I am sort of new to VPNs, but am learning.
>
> I have a WatchGuard XTM 505 with 11.6.3 firmware and Management
> software 11.6. I set up a Mobile VPN using IPSec. Clients are using
> the Shrewsoft VPN client.
>
> All of the clients connected fine and it seems to work with one major
> problem, they all get connected after an hour or so on connection.
> When this happens it causes a loss of work on their part and they have
> to reconnect.  Is there a way to keep the connection open longer?
>

Hi Tommy,

The first thing I look at when I see disconnects after a consistent amount of 
time is the Phase 1 and Phase 2 Key Life Times.  Make sure that the settings in 
the Shrew Site Configuration match exactly with what the VPN Gateway (the 
WatchGuard) is set to.  If they do not match, they will not renegotiate keys 
properly, resulting in disconnects.
